Guilford Foundation Awards $1500 Grant to ERACE

Guilford Foundation has announced the award of a $1500 Grant to the East Shore Region Adult & Continuing Education program (ERACE).  Several funds of the Guilford Foundation contributed to this grant, the Stuart Burt Fund, Corky Fisher Fund and the Al and Gene Bishop Fund for Vocational and Industrial Arts.

ERACE proposes to offer Job shadowing experiences with local businesses for high school completion students (CDP, GED, NEDP) with the program made available this Fall 2014. ERACE welcomes this generous grant as an enriching opportunity for those students who need work experiences as they prepare for personal career choices.

ERACE is dedicated to providing comprehensive and responsive opportunities for all adult learners who seek academic and personal growth, supported in a professional environment to meet diverse student needs.
